Subject: Re: [RFC 01/10] mm/gup.c: Remove redundant check for PCI P2PDMA page


David Hildenbrand <david@...hat.com> writes:

> On 11.04.24 02:57, Alistair Popple wrote:
>> PCI P2PDMA pages are not mapped with pXX_devmap PTEs therefore the
>> check in __gup_device_huge() is redundant. Remove it
>> Signed-off-by: Alistair Popple <apopple@...dia.com>
>> ---
>>   mm/gup.c | 5 -----
>>   1 file changed, 5 deletions(-)
>> diff --git a/mm/gup.c b/mm/gup.c
>> index 2f8a2d8..a9c8a09 100644
>> --- a/mm/gup.c
>> +++ b/mm/gup.c
>> @@ -2683,11 +2683,6 @@ static int __gup_device_huge(unsigned long pfn, unsigned long addr,
>>   			break;
>>   		}
>>   -		if (!(flags & FOLL_PCI_P2PDMA) &&
>> is_pci_p2pdma_page(page)) {
>> -			undo_dev_pagemap(nr, nr_start, flags, pages);
>> -			break;
>> -		}
>> -
>>   		SetPageReferenced(page);
>>   		pages[*nr] = page;
>>   		if (unlikely(try_grab_page(page, flags))) {
